Specification:
Weight 13 oz (approx. 368 grams)
Dimensions in Use W = 25 in, H = 39 in, L = 48 in
Pack Size 6.5 in x 4.5 in
Seating Capacity Suitable for 2 people
Materials and Features Waterproof fabric with mesh vents, clear windows, durable waterproof seats, roof socket for walking poles
Additional Support Roof socket compatible with walking poles for extra stability

What Is a Bothy Bag and How Does It Work?

A bothy bag is a lightweight, portable emergency shelter designed to provide temporary protection from harsh weather conditions for outdoor enthusiasts. Typically made from waterproof and breathable materials, bothy bags can accommodate multiple people and are used primarily in situations where quick refuge from wind, rain, or cold is necessary, such as during hiking, climbing, or mountain biking expeditions.

According to the UK Mountain Rescue, bothy bags are essential safety equipment for those venturing into the wilderness, providing a critical lifeline during unexpected weather changes or emergencies. The use of bothy bags is endorsed by organizations such as the British Mountaineering Council, which emphasizes their role in promoting safety in the outdoors.

Key aspects of bothy bags include their lightweight construction, ease of setup, and ability to shelter multiple individuals. They are often equipped with reflective materials to enhance visibility in low-light conditions and usually feature a simple design that allows for quick deployment. Some models may include a floor, while others rely on the ground for insulation, making them versatile for various situations. Their compact nature allows for easy storage in a backpack, ensuring that adventurers are prepared without being burdened by extra weight.

This impacts outdoor safety significantly, as bothy bags provide crucial shelter that can prevent hypothermia and other cold-related illnesses during emergencies. Statistics from the Royal National Lifeboat Institution indicate that a significant percentage of outdoor injuries are related to weather exposure, highlighting the importance of being prepared with appropriate gear like a bothy bag. In addition, their utility extends beyond emergencies; they can also be used for rest breaks during long hikes, providing a place to regroup and replenish energy.

The benefits of using a bothy bag include enhanced safety and comfort during outdoor activities. They are particularly beneficial in remote areas where access to immediate shelter is limited. Additionally, bothy bags can serve as a communal space for groups, fostering teamwork and camaraderie among adventurers. The ability to share body heat in a confined space can also be crucial in maintaining warmth during unexpected weather changes.

Best practices for using a bothy bag include selecting the appropriate size for your group, ensuring it is easily accessible in your pack, and familiarizing yourself with its setup before heading out. It is advisable to practice using the bag in a controlled environment to ensure everyone knows how to deploy it efficiently. Furthermore, checking the weather forecast and planning accordingly can help minimize the need for emergency shelters, although having a bothy bag on hand is always recommended for safety.

What Should You Look for When Choosing the Best Bothy Bag?

When choosing the best bothy bag, consider the following factors:

  • Size: The size of the bothy bag is crucial as it determines how many people can comfortably fit inside it. A larger bag is ideal for group outings, while a smaller bag may be more suitable for solo hikers or small teams.
  • Weight: The weight of the bothy bag affects portability, especially for long treks. Lighter materials are preferable to avoid adding unnecessary strain to your load while ensuring that the bag remains durable and functional.
  • Material: The fabric of the bothy bag should be weather-resistant and durable. Look for materials like ripstop nylon or polyester that can withstand harsh conditions and provide adequate insulation against wind and rain.
  • Ease of Setup: A good bothy bag should be quick and easy to set up, ideally allowing for fast deployment in emergency situations. Features such as simple drawstring closures or easy-to-use zippers can significantly enhance usability.
  • Ventilation: Proper ventilation is essential to prevent condensation buildup inside the bothy bag. Look for models that have mesh panels or vents to allow airflow while still providing shelter from the elements.
  • Visibility: Brightly colored bothy bags enhance safety by making your shelter easily visible in various environments. This is particularly important in emergency situations or when needing to signal for help.
  • Storage Options: Some bothy bags come with internal pockets or loops for gear storage, which can help keep items organized and easily accessible. This feature is particularly useful for maintaining order during group outings or when multiple items need to be stored safely.
  • Price: Budget is always a consideration when choosing outdoor gear. It’s important to find a balance between quality and cost, ensuring that you invest in a bothy bag that meets your needs without overspending.

How Can a Bothy Bag Enhance Safety During Outdoor Activities?

A bothy bag is a vital piece of gear that can significantly enhance safety during outdoor activities by providing shelter and warmth in emergency situations.

  • Emergency Shelter: A bothy bag offers immediate protection from harsh weather conditions such as rain, wind, or snow. Its ability to create a temporary refuge can be lifesaving, allowing outdoor enthusiasts to wait for rescue or recover from exhaustion without exposure to the elements.
  • Insulation: These bags are designed to trap heat, providing a more comfortable environment for users. By using a bothy bag, individuals can maintain body temperature during unexpected delays or emergencies, reducing the risk of hypothermia.
  • Group Use: Bothy bags are typically large enough to accommodate multiple people, making them ideal for group outings. This feature fosters collective safety, as everyone can huddle together for warmth and protection, enhancing the overall safety of the group.
  • Lightweight and Portable: Most bothy bags are made from lightweight materials that make them easy to carry in a backpack. Their portability ensures that outdoor enthusiasts can have them on hand without adding significant weight to their gear, encouraging preparedness for unforeseen circumstances.
  • Visibility: Many bothy bags come in bright colors, making them easily visible in the wilderness. This visibility can help rescuers locate individuals in distress, improving the chances of a swift recovery in emergency situations.
  • Quick Deployment: Bothy bags are designed for rapid setup, allowing users to create shelter within seconds. This quick deployment is crucial in emergencies when time is of the essence and can make a significant difference in survival situations.

How Should You Properly Use and Maintain a Bothy Bag to Ensure Longevity?

Proper storage involves keeping the bothy bag in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ight, which can degrade materials. Folding it neatly and avoiding cramming it into tight spaces will help preserve its shape and functionality.

Avoiding overloading the bothy bag is important as exceeding its capacity can strain seams and zippers, leading to premature wear. Always adhere to the manufacturer’s recommendations regarding weight limits for optimal performance.

Patching up damage promptly means using appropriate repair kits or materials to fix any tears or holes before they expand. Quick repairs can extend the life of the bag significantly and ensure that it remains a reliable shelter when needed.
